... so, 45 sleep mins later I make it to the bus in time to get to Sagres (via Lagos). Why sleep 45 minutes? I dunno, I shoulda just stayed up! 45 mins sleep just makes ya feel odd, especially when your body is crying for more.
It takes about 5 and a half hours in two busses to get down to Sagres and it is worth every bit of it! I passed through Lagos having a look but the cheesy drunken British and Aussie side of the place just turned me right off so I skipped that shit and went straight for the gold that was Sagres. A pretty sleepy feeling small beach town, it was an el natural recharge and a good slow down the first night. We booked up some surfing before dinner too, which again pointed out how badly addicted to it I am as it almost gave me butterflies in the stomach thinking that Id get to hit the water soon!!
A full nights sleep later, probably equalling all the sleep ive had on the trip so far, we head out with the surf crew, grab the boards from their shop, and they take us out through dirt paths and all sortsa stuff to this cool little surf spot you'll see on the photos below... to say I was sitting on a cloud happyness wise when we got there is a serious underestimate. Im so addicted to the coast and surf areas it probably isnt healthy. I got me a 6'4 fish board, and the waves just crumbled! None of this scarborough close out every time and barrel in a bad way when big, just smooth crumbling waves almost
Storm setting in...
We got some rain towards the end as some bad weather rolled in, but with the cliffs and look of the land it was pretty spectacular longboarding in style. Its a kind small enclosed cliff area too, giving you awesome reference points to hold your position in the lineup. Heh I went with Nancy and did the learning to surf basics too which was funny as, learning how to paddle and stand up and shit, felt pretty goofy when you already know how to do it all... once out though we surfed all day until the energy levels got too low and before hyperthermia set in (the ocean there is icey as!!).
